Aerial Apparatus: More than Just Water Towers

Now, you may be thinking: aren’t there other aerial options available, like aerial ladders or quints? Absolutely! Each has its own place in the firefighting arsenal, but let’s break them down a bit.

  • Aerial Ladders: These pieces of equipment are designed primarily for access and rescue operations. They extend to reach higher spots for those precious few who may be trapped. While they offer flexibility—like being able to go up and down in a hurry—their main purpose isn’t to deliver massive streams of water.

  • Quints: Ah, the multi-taskers! Quints are fascinating because they combine the capabilities of a fire truck, aerial ladder, and pump all rolled into one. However, while they can pump water, they don’t specialize in deploying elevated master streams the way a water tower does.

  • Fire Trucks: Essential for any firefighting mission, these vehicles carry hoses, equipment, and firefighters to the scene. But if you’re looking for that aerial advantage during a large-scale blaze, you’ll want a water tower on your side.

So while each of these vehicles plays a pivotal role in firefighting efforts, it’s the water tower that truly dominates when it comes to high-volume water deployment on a massive scale.

The Mechanics of Water Towers

Let’s get a little technical here—don’t worry; I won’t bog you down with too much jargon. Water towers are designed with a few key components that allow them to function effectively. They typically feature:

  • A High-Pressure Nozzle: This is where the magic happens. The nozzle releases a powerful stream of water at significant heights, which is crucial for combating high-rise fires.

  • An Elevated Platform: Many water towers have platforms that provide fire crews access to elevated areas. Imagine being able to spot that one hot spot from way up high.

  • Pump Systems: These systems supply water at pressure, pushing it up through the nozzle. Without the right pumping power, a water tower wouldn’t be able to deliver that impressive stream we’re talking about.
